Mentor IMC Group announces new Group MD appointment

Wednesday, Jan 09, 2013

Global oil and gas project management resource specialists Mentor IMC Group has announced the appointment of Simon Bonini as Group Managing Director as part of its international growth strategy.

Bonini has 25 years’ experience in the oil and gas industry with his most recent post being Director LNG at Centrica, having previously played a key role in the growth of BG’s LNG business.  He is responsible for supporting and helping to manage Mentor IMC Group’s rapid expansion within the oil, gas and LNG sectors, following recent significant contract wins across East Africa, Asia and Australia.

A graduate of Imperial College London in Chemical Engineering and a Chartered Engineer with an MBA, Bonini was a founder board member and Chief Operating Officer of private equity company 4Gas, whose largest shareholder is the Carlyle Group.

Mentor IMC Group CEO, John Richards, said: “We are entering an exciting phase of international growth with leading oil and gas industry clients and projects; Simon brings extensive global project management know-how, commercial experience and market insight to the company.

“He has expertise within process engineering, business development and LNG market development, which is an area of significant interest to Mentor. We are delighted to welcome someone of Simon’s calibre to the organisation.”

Twice listed in The Sunday Times Fast Track 100, Mentor IMC Group has tasked its new MD with maintaining the company’s high level of client service as it consults on an increasing number of multi-national oil and gas projects.

Simon said: “Over the past 25 years, Mentor IMC Group has established a reputation for excellence in providing high quality project management services across the globe. The business continues to grow strongly and I look forward to helping the company enhance and fulfil its considerable potential. I have spent the past two decades building businesses in this sector from the client perspective and I know the value of access to key markets and excellent people. I am confident that this experience will benefit Mentor IMC Group as it continues to consolidate and develop its position within the oil and gas industry.”
